Publisher Profile - AMAR CHITRA KATHA
Amar Chitra Katha, our flagship brand, was founded in 1967 and is a household name in India. It is synonymous with the visual reinvention of the quintessentially Indian stories from the great epics, mythology, history, literature, oral folktales and many other sources. With more than 400 comics in 20+ languages that have sold 90+ million copies to date, Amar Chitra Katha is a cultural phenomenon. With a national distribution across all major book retailers, hundreds of small bookstores and thousands of vendors, the titles remain immensely popular in the classic illustrated format. With more than 1.5 million copies sold every year, it is the best selling children's publication in India. Amar Chitra Katha is also launching these stories in animated, live-action and gaming formats for all screens - television, film, mobile and online
